I enjoyed his previous book, Drood, and was excited to get this one. I was so bored! I broke my cardinal rule and requested the unabridged version, and found it to be needlessly wordy. I did not like the pace of the book either. It would go back and forth between time periods when it would have been much better if presented in "real-time" I actually misplaced the last 3 discs and didn't bother to look for them as I really didn't care what happened and because of the time jumps, i already knew the character would get through this particular peril, unscathed.
